The similarities and differences between organic pigments and dyes, inorganic pigments briefly

2016.03.17   10:43

As is known to all, colorants basic divided into organic pigments and dyes, inorganic pigments, organic pigments has been developing rapidly recently. With the other two kinds of colorants what are the similarities and differences?

The differences between organic pigment and dye

Organic pigment and dye are colored organic compounds, from the perspective of the chemical structure of organic pigments and dyes, both are very similar, even some organic compounds can be used as a dye and can be used as organic pigment, but organic pigment and dye is two different concepts, application performance difference between them is different. The traditional use of dye is to dyeing of textiles, and the traditional use of pigment is of textiles (such as ink, paint, coatings, plastics, rubber, etc.) staining. Textiles have an affinity for this is because the dye (or direct), can be fiber molecular adsorption, sessile; On all paint color objects are no affinity, mainly by resin, adhesives and other film forming material and color objects together. Dye in the process of using soluble in first commonly used medium, even disperse dye and VAT dye, also experienced a when dyeing from crystal soluble in water first become molecular state after dyeing on the fiber process. As a result, the color of the dye itself doesn't mean it in the color of the fabric. Pigments in use process, due to insoluble in working medium, so always exist in the original state of crystal. Therefore, the color of the paint itself represents its color in the substrate. Because of this, of a crystallization of the pigment for paints is very important, and of a crystallization of the dye is less important, or of a crystallization of the dye itself is not close relationship with its dyeing behavior.

Pigments and dyes are different concepts, but in certain cases, they can general again. For example some anthraquinones VAT dye, they are insoluble dyes, but after also can be used as a pigment. This kind of dye, called pigment dyes, pigment or dye.

The differences between organic pigments and inorganic pigments

Compared with inorganic pigments, organic pigments have many unique advantages. By changing the molecular structure of organic pigments can be prepared in a wide range of varieties, and have more vivid colors than inorganic pigment, more bright colors. Organic pigment also has a much higher than inorganic pigment tinting strength, can be prepared high tinting strength, high transparency of varieties, to meet the requirements of high-grade coatings and printing ink. Most of the varieties of organic pigment less toxicity, and most of the inorganic pigments containing heavy metals, such as chrome yellow, red lead, scarlet, etc all have certain toxicity. Low-grade varieties of organic pigment in sun fastness, weathering resistance, heat resistance and solvent resistance to various aspects, such as inferior to inorganic pigments, but some high-grade organic pigment varieties (such as: quetiapine acridone pigments, phthalocyanine pigment, etc.) are excellent sun fastness, weathering resistance, heat resistance and solvent resistance, and acid/alkali can also better than the inorganic pigment, because of some inorganic pigment acid/alkali can lower, such as: will get black, chrome yellow in the hydrogen sulfide in alkali will turn red; Ultramarine blue easily by acid decomposition. Organic pigments varieties, types, production and application range are growing and expanding, has become a kind of important fine chemical products.
